Master Pages - Examining the Markup Emitted by the ScriptManager Control

Master Pages - Examining the Markup Emitted by the ScriptManager ControlOver the past several years, more and more developers have been building AJAX-enabled web applications. An AJAX-enabled website uses a number of related web technologies to offer a more responsive user experience. Creating AJAX-enabled ASP.NET applications is amazingly easy thanks to Microsoft’s ASP.NET AJAX framework. ASP.NET AJAX is built into ASP.NET 3.5 and Visual Studio 2008; it is also available as a separate download for ASP.NET 2.0 applications.
When building AJAX-enabled web pages with the ASP.NET AJAX framework, you must add precisely one ScriptManager control to each and every page that uses the framework. As its name implies, the ScriptManager manages the client-side script used in AJAX-enabled web pages. At a minimum, the ScriptManager emits HTML that instructs the browser to download the JavaScript files that makeup the ASP.NET AJAX Client Library. It can also be used to register custom JavaScript files, script-enabled web services, and custom application service functionality.
If your site uses master pages (as it should), you do not necessarily need to add a ScriptManager control to every single content page; rather, you can add a ScriptManager control to the master page. This tutorial shows how to add the ScriptManager control to the master page. It also looks at how to use the ScriptManagerProxy control to register custom scripts and script services in a specific content page.

Working with Data in ASP.NET 2.0 - Debugging Stored Procedures

Working with Data in ASP.NET 2.0 - Debugging Stored ProceduresVisual Studio provides a rich debugging experience. With a few keystrokes or clicks of the mouse, it’s possible to use breakpoints to stop execution of a program and examine its state and control flow. Along with debugging application code, Visual Studio offers support for debugging stored procedures from within SQL Server. Just like breakpoints can be set within the code of an ASP.NET codebehind class or Business Logic Layer class, so too can they be placed within stored procedures.

Working with Data in ASP.NET 2.0 - Querying Data with the SqlDataSource Control

Working with Data in ASP.NET 2.0 - Querying Data with the SqlDataSource ControlAll of the tutorials we’ve examined so far have used a tiered architecture consisting of presentation, Business Logic, and Data Access layers. The Data Access Layer (DAL) was crafted in the first tutorial (Creating a Data Access Layer) and the Business Logic Layer in the second (Creating a Business Logic Layer). Starting with the Displaying Data With the ObjectDataSource tutorial, we saw how to use ASP.NET 2.0’s new ObjectDataSource control to declaratively interface with the architecture from the presentation layer. While all of the tutorials so far have used the architecture to work with data, it is also possible to access, insert, update, and delete database data directly from an ASP.NET page, bypassing the architecture. Doing so places the specific database queries and business logic directly in the web page. For sufficiently large or complex applications, designing, implementing, and using a tiered architecture is vitally important for the success, updatability, and maintainability of the application. Developing a robust architecture, however, can be overkill when creating exceedingly simple, oneoff applications.
